Lyman do a mould in .312 you can also use it in a .303 so you could also use it in a lee enfield. I have one some were I think its a
180 grain boolit but I would have to check.
But if your groove diameter is .313 then you rally need a boolit in .313 or .314
Or just get some boolits off Rog and ask him to size them yo what you want.
